Lonicera rupicola Hook.f. & Thomson

 
  • Family : CAPRIFOLIACEAE
    (Honeysuckle Family)
  • Family (Hindi name) : RASHINA FAMILY
  • Family (as per The APG System III) : Caprifoliaceae
  • Synonym(s) : Caprifolium rupicola Kuntze; Devendraea rupicola (Hook.f. & Thomson) Pusalkar; Lonicera rupicola subsp. thibetica (Bureau & Franch.) Y.C.Tang; Lonicera thibetica Bureau & Franch.
  • Species Name (as per The IPNI) : Lonicera rupicola Hook.f. & Thomson
  • Habit : Shrub
  • Habitat : Alpine scrub and meadows, rock crevices, scree slopes, grasslands, forest margins, deserts; 2000 - 5000 m. altitude
  • Flower, Fruit : May-October
  • Distribution :
    • Uttarakhand : Uttarakhand
    • Sikkim : North Sikkim (Mangan) district
  • Native : Bhutan, China, East Himalaya, India, Inner Mongolia, Nepal, Qinghai, Tibet
  • Exotic/Native : Native
  • World Distribution : Himalaya to North and Central China
